A Vacancy at East Kent Hospitals University NHS Foundation Trust.


We are looking for an expert in Heart Failure, with linked skills in
cardiac MRI or complex device implantation. Expertise in
complementary areas such as Advanced Echocardiography,
Inherited Cardiac Conditions, Maternal and Congenital Heart
Disease or Cardio-oncology would be considered. This is a
substantive appointment within a team of 18 full time consultants
working across the organisation.

The Heart Failure service works closely with Kent Community
Health NHS Foundation Trust to deliver comprehensive inpatient
and outpatient services across the region.

Cardiology in East Kent Hospitals is one of the largest services in
the South East, and is the regional heart attack centre for Kent
and Medway, the 7th busiest in the UK.

This is a full-time 10 PA position, with additional sessions according to the post holder’s skill set.

A typical week includes general heart failure and speciality outpatient clinics, multi-disciplinary meetings with acute and community specialist nursing teams. According to skill mix, 2 – 3 sessions in clinical imaging, device implantation, or other linked clinical activity, delivered across all sites, will be expected.

The EKHUFT Heart Failure Service consists of a Lead Consultant (this post) and 7 Heart Failure Specialist Nurses, including independent nurse prescribers. There are strong links with the Kent Community Heath Heart Failure Service, and with inpatient and community rehab services. The Trust has delivered an ambulatory diuretic service for many years, now complemented by a full virtual ward service, including at home diuretics and remote monitoring. The post holder will possess skills to lead these services, and offer development in new areas of growth as we seek to deliver regional services locally, reducing the need for our patients to travel outside the East Kent where possible.



We are one of the largest hospital trusts in England, with three acute hospitals and community sites serving a local population of around 760,000. We also provide specialist services for Kent and Medway.
